Recognizing Cataract Surgical Procedure Refine



Checking out the actions associated with cataract surgical procedure can aid ease any kind of stress and anxiety or uncertainty you might have regarding the procedure. Cataract surgical treatment is a typical and highly successful treatment that involves removing the gloomy lens in your eye and replacing it with a clear fabricated lens.

Prior to the surgical procedure, your eye will certainly be numbed with eye decreases or a shot to ensure you do not feel any kind of pain throughout the procedure. The specialist will make a tiny laceration in your eye to access the cataract and break it up using ultrasound waves before carefully removing it.

As soon as the cataract is gotten rid of, the synthetic lens will be put in its area. The whole surgical treatment generally takes about 15-30 minutes per eye and is usually done one eye at once.

After the surgical procedure, you may experience some mild pain or obscured vision, yet this is typical and ought to enhance as your eye heals.

Post-Operative Care Tips



After cataract surgery, providing proper post-operative care is critical for your liked one's recovery. Ensure they use the protective shield over their eye as instructed by the doctor. Help them provide recommended eye declines and medicines in a timely manner to prevent infection and help recovery.

Encourage your enjoyed one to avoid touching or scrubing their eyes, as this can cause problems. Help them in following any type of limitations on bending, raising hefty items, or joining strenuous activities to avoid pressure on the eyes. Make certain they go to all follow-up visits with the eye doctor for keeping an eye on progress.
